HOUSTON, April 5 (UPI) -- Tim Lincecum, two-time winner of the National League Cy Young Award, shut out Houston through seven innings Friday and San Francisco downed the Astros 5-2.
Mark DeRosa hit a home run in the eighth inning to give San Francisco a 5-0 cushion and both Bengie Molina and Juan Uribe had two hits and an RBI during a three-run second.
Lincecum gave up four hits and struck out seven. He did not walk a batter during his second straight opening-day start.
Brian Wilson retired two in the ninth to pick up the save.
Roy Oswalt took the loss, giving up three runs on seven hits in six innings. He opened the season on the mound for the eighth straight year.
Houston had not been shut out on opening day in 18 seasons.
